AMC Entertainment files to sell 11 million shares, sending the stock down 30%. ExxonMobil loses a proxy fight as an activist firm gains a 3rd seat on the board of directors. Bill Mann analyzes those stories and FireEye’s decision to sell part of its business (and its name) to a private equity firm.
